Mistakes do occur in hospitals
By Lee Hui Chieh
A PATIENT about to get a kidney transplant almost received an organ of the wrong blood type at a hospital here last year.

The mistake was spotted and corrected in time, and the operation was carried out successfully.

It was the only near-miss of its kind reported in the last six years that came to light in a Health Ministry review of what can go terribly wrong in hospitals here.
